
Shifting weight correctly during the golf downswing is crucial for generating power, maintaining balance, and ensuring a consistent strike. The process begins with a lateral shift of weight from the back foot to the front foot, typically initiated just before or at the start of the downswing. This weight transfer helps to unwind the hips and torso, creating a powerful rotation that drives the clubhead through the ball. Proper timing is essential; shifting too early can lead to an inconsistent strike, while delaying the shift can result in a loss of power. By focusing on a smooth, controlled transition and synchronizing the weight shift with the rotation of the body, golfers can optimize their downswing mechanics and improve overall performance on the course.

Timing of weight shift initiation
The timing of weight shift initiation in the golf downswing is a critical yet often misunderstood element of the swing sequence. Many golfers mistakenly believe the shift should begin at the start of the downswing, but this can lead to an over-the-top move, causing slices or pulls. Instead, the weight shift should commence slightly later, as the club approaches the slot position, ensuring the body and club work in harmony. This delay allows the golfer to maintain control and generate power efficiently, rather than rushing the transition and losing stability.
Analyzing the biomechanics, the weight shift should initiate when the lead hip begins to clear, typically as the shaft reaches a 45-degree angle relative to the ground. This timing ensures the lower body supports the unwinding of the upper body, creating a seamless transfer of energy. For instance, a golfer with a 100 mph swing speed might feel this shift occurring just as the clubhead is about the pass the hands on the downswing. Too early, and the golfer risks casting the club; too late, and power is lost due to inadequate sequencing.
Instructively, golfers can practice this timing by focusing on the sensation of the lead heel pressing into the ground as the club approaches impact. A drill to reinforce this is the "step-and-swing" exercise: take a small step forward with the lead foot at the start of the downswing, mimicking the weight shift. This exaggerates the movement, helping ingrain the correct feel. Pair this with slow-motion swings, emphasizing the lead hip clearing before the shoulders fully rotate, to build muscle memory.
Comparatively, the weight shift in golf mirrors the loading and unloading phases in other sports, such as pitching in baseball or serving in tennis. In each case, the initiation of the weight transfer is delayed until the optimal moment to maximize power and accuracy. Golfers can draw parallels by observing how athletes in these sports coil and uncoil their bodies, applying the same principles to their swing. For example, a tennis player’s weight shifts to the front foot just as the racket makes contact with the ball—a timing golfers should emulate.
Practically, golfers should avoid common pitfalls like sliding the hips laterally instead of rotating them or letting the upper body outrace the lower body. A useful tip is to maintain a slight knee flex in the lead leg throughout the downswing, ensuring stability and control during the weight shift. Video analysis can also provide immediate feedback, allowing golfers to see if their shift aligns with the club’s position. By mastering this timing, golfers can achieve a more consistent and powerful ball strike, turning a complex movement into a repeatable action.

Role of hip rotation in shifting
Hip rotation is the catalyst that initiates the weight shift in the golf downswing, transforming a static setup into a dynamic, powerful motion. As the lead hip begins to clear—rotating toward the target—it naturally pulls the body’s center of gravity forward. This movement is not just about turning; it’s about timing and sequence. The hips must start moving before the arms and club, creating a kinetic chain that maximizes energy transfer. Without this early hip rotation, the weight shift becomes delayed or forced, leading to inconsistent strikes and lost distance. Think of it as the spark that ignites the engine of your swing.
To execute this effectively, focus on a 45-degree hip turn during the backswing, then unleash the rotation as you start down. A common mistake is letting the upper body dominate, causing the hips to lag. Instead, visualize your belt buckle moving toward the target as you begin the downswing. For golfers over 50 or those with limited flexibility, a slight modification can help: allow the hips to rotate 70% of their full capacity, ensuring comfort while maintaining functionality. This approach preserves power without straining the lower back.
Comparing hip rotation to other weight-shifting mechanisms highlights its efficiency. While lateral movement of the lower body is necessary, it’s the rotational force that drives the shift. For instance, a purely lateral slide lacks the torque needed to generate clubhead speed. Conversely, excessive rotation without forward movement results in an unbalanced swing. The sweet spot lies in combining both—a forward shift fueled by hip rotation. This synergy is evident in professional swings, where the hips clear just as the weight reaches the lead foot, creating a seamless transition.
Practical drills can reinforce this connection. Try the "hip bump" drill: stand in your address position, then rotate your lead hip toward the target while keeping your upper body back. Feel the weight naturally shift forward. Repeat this 10 times daily to build muscle memory. Another tip: place a club across your hips during practice swings to ensure they lead the motion. These exercises emphasize the hips’ role as the primary driver of the weight shift, not just a passive participant.
Ultimately, mastering hip rotation in the downswing is about control and precision. It’s not just about moving weight; it’s about moving it *with purpose*. By prioritizing hip rotation, golfers can achieve a more consistent, powerful swing. Remember, the hips are the foundation—let them dictate the timing, and the rest will follow. This principle applies across skill levels, from beginners to pros, making it a cornerstone of effective golf mechanics.

Maintaining balance during transition
The transition from backswing to downswing is a delicate dance, and balance is the key to mastering this critical moment in your golf swing. Imagine a tightrope walker, poised and focused, taking that first step onto the rope. This is your golfer's equivalent, where a slight misstep can lead to a disastrous slice or a weak, unbalanced shot. The weight shift during this transition is not just about power; it's about control and precision.
The Art of Timing:
In the world of golf, timing is everything. As you initiate the downswing, the weight shift should begin with a subtle movement of your lower body. Think of it as a coiled spring releasing its energy. Start by pushing your hips towards the target, allowing your weight to transfer from the back foot to the front. This movement should be synchronized with the uncoiling of your upper body, creating a seamless flow of energy. The key is to avoid rushing this process; a premature weight shift can lead to an early release, causing inconsistent ball striking.
Feel the Ground Reaction:
Maintaining balance is an art of feeling the ground beneath you. As you shift your weight, focus on the pressure points on your feet. During the transition, you should sense a gradual increase in pressure on the inside of your front foot, indicating a successful weight transfer. This ground reaction force is your feedback mechanism, ensuring you're on the right path. For instance, if you feel excessive pressure on your back foot, it's a sign of a delayed weight shift, which might result in a steep, out-to-in swing path.
Drill for Balance:
To master this balance, incorporate a simple drill into your practice routine. Set up with a golf ball and align two clubs on the ground, one on each side of the ball, creating a narrow channel. The goal is to swing and hit the ball while keeping your weight centered and avoiding contact with the clubs. This drill encourages a controlled weight shift, promoting a balanced swing. Start with slower swings and gradually increase speed as you improve.
The Takeaway:
Maintaining balance during the transition is about precision and body awareness. It's a skill that separates the amateurs from the pros. By focusing on the timing of your weight shift and understanding the ground reaction forces, you can achieve a powerful and controlled downswing. Remember, it's not just about shifting weight but doing so with grace and purpose, ensuring every swing is a step towards a lower handicap. This technique is a cornerstone of a consistent and reliable golf game.

Impact of weight distribution on power
Weight distribution during the golf downswing is a critical factor in maximizing power and control. The timing and sequence of weight shift directly influence the efficiency of energy transfer from the body to the clubhead. At the start of the downswing, approximately 60% of the golfer’s weight should remain on the back foot, maintaining stored energy from the backswing. Prematurely shifting weight to the front foot at this stage can lead to a loss of power and inconsistent ball striking. This initial stability allows the golfer to harness the potential energy built up during the backswing, setting the stage for a powerful release.
As the downswing progresses, a deliberate and controlled weight shift becomes essential. The transition begins when the shaft reaches parallel to the ground, with weight gradually moving toward the target side. By the time the club reaches the impact zone, roughly 90% of the golfer’s weight should be on the front foot. This shift creates a downward and forward force, optimizing the angle of attack and ensuring the clubhead meets the ball with maximum speed. For example, professional golfers like Dustin Johnson and Rory McIlroy demonstrate this principle, their weight visibly transferring to the front foot just before impact, contributing to their impressive driving distances.
However, the speed and timing of the weight shift require precision. A too-rapid shift can cause an early release, leading to thin shots or a loss of control. Conversely, a delayed shift may result in a "hanging back" motion, reducing power and causing mis-hits. Amateurs often struggle with this timing, emphasizing the need for drills to reinforce proper sequencing. One effective practice is the "step drill," where golfers step forward with their front foot at the start of the downswing, training the body to initiate the shift at the correct moment.
The biomechanics of weight distribution also play a role in injury prevention. An abrupt or unbalanced shift can place excessive stress on the lower back and hips, common trouble spots for golfers. Maintaining a gradual and controlled transition ensures the body moves as a cohesive unit, reducing the risk of strain. For golfers over 50 or those with pre-existing conditions, focusing on a smooth weight transfer can extend playing longevity while maintaining power.
In conclusion, mastering weight distribution during the downswing is a cornerstone of generating power in golf. The sequence begins with stability, progresses with a timed shift, and culminates in a forceful release at impact. By understanding and practicing this principle, golfers can optimize their swings, increase distance, and minimize the risk of injury. Whether through drills, video analysis, or professional instruction, refining this aspect of the swing yields tangible improvements on the course.

Common mistakes in weight shifting technique
One of the most common errors in the golf downswing is an overly aggressive weight shift too early in the transition from backswing to downswing. Many golfers mistakenly believe that a forceful lateral move toward the target will generate more power. However, this premature shift often leads to an out-to-in swing path, resulting in slices or pulls. The hips and lower body should initiate the downswing, but this movement must be timed precisely with the unwinding of the upper body. Shifting weight too soon disrupts the natural sequencing of the swing, causing the club to approach the ball from an inefficient angle. To avoid this, focus on a controlled, gradual shift that begins as the lead shoulder drops and the hands start downward, ensuring the body and club work in harmony.
Another frequent mistake is insufficient weight transfer during the downswing, which often stems from a fear of losing balance or control. Golfers who maintain too much weight on their back foot tend to lift out of their posture, leading to thin shots or topped balls. Proper weight transfer is essential for maximizing power and ensuring solid contact. Aim to shift at least 60% of your weight onto your lead foot by the time you reach impact. Practice drills like the "step drill"—where you take a small step forward with your lead foot at the start of the downswing—can help reinforce this movement. Remember, a full weight shift is not just lateral but also involves a vertical lift as you rotate through the ball.
A less obvious but equally detrimental error is reverse weight shift, where golfers inadvertently move weight back onto their trailing foot during the downswing. This often occurs when players try to "help" the ball into the air by lifting their head or leaning backward. Reverse weight shift reduces power, causes fat shots, and compromises consistency. To prevent this, maintain a steady head position throughout the swing and focus on rotating your chest toward the target rather than swaying. A useful cue is to imagine keeping your sternum over your lead knee as you approach impact. This promotes a stable lower body and ensures the weight moves in the correct direction.
Lastly, many golfers overlook the importance of timing and coordination in weight shifting. A rushed or jerky transition from backswing to downswing can cause the weight to shift unevenly, leading to inconsistent ball striking. The downswing should feel like a fluid, sequential unwinding, starting with the lower body and followed by the torso, arms, and club. Practice slow-motion swings to internalize the proper sequence and ensure each part of your body moves in sync. Incorporating a pause at the top of your backswing can also help you initiate the downswing with control, allowing for a more precise weight shift. Mastery of this timing is key to transforming weight transfer from a mistake-prone maneuver into a reliable source of power and accuracy.
